No Nabby, no Cheech, and up until last Sunday, no problem.The Teal are clearly motivated to do something this year, because they're playing strong, 60 minute contests. They're hitting, forechecking, shooting, crashing the net, anything it is taking to win, they're doing the job. A quick recap of some highlights recently...* The Boys in Teal took down both Cup finalists in the same week defeating the Penguins 2-1 and the Wings 4-2. * A 7 game win streak was only snapped on Sunday with a loss in Phoenix* Brian Boucher is 1-1 since taking over for the injured (unknown injury) Evgeni Nabokov.* The Sharks are 9-0 at the HP Pavilion this yearSay what you will about this Sharks squad, but they clearly look like a different team. Games are no longer being won by sitting on leads for 30-40 minutes, they're being won with 60 minutes of pressure.
